McGregor sits in Essex County at the southwestern tip of Ontario, one of the most temperate pockets in all of Canada — the same Carolinian climate that gives the region its tobacco history, its wine trails, and growing seasons most of the country can only envy. Golf here tends to run long into the shoulder seasons, and the flat, fertile landscape that defines this corner of southwestern Ontario shapes the kind of course you find: open, playable, and rooted in the rhythms of agricultural land rather than dramatic elevation.
Coachwood Golf and Country Club brings a country club atmosphere to a community not far from Windsor and the Detroit River border crossing, offering members and guests a full 18-hole layout in a region with a quietly serious local golf culture. The par-70 configuration signals a design that rewards precision and course management over raw power — shorter par 4s or a reduced par-5 count means scoring opportunities are there, but so are the chances to give those shots right back.
For visiting golfers, Essex County makes for an underrated destination. The area's proximity to Windsor gives it a small-city convenience, while McGregor itself retains a rural character that makes a round at a club like Coachwood feel unhurried and genuinely local.
| Tee | Yards | Rating | Slope | Par |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Championship · men | 6,189 | 69.5 | 123 | 70 |
| Championship · women | 6,189 | 75.4 | 131 | 72 |
| Regulation · men | 5,797 | 67.7 | 119 | 68 |
| Regulation · women | 5,797 | 73.3 | 127 | 72 |
| Forward · men | 5,157 | 64.5 | 109 | 68 |
| Forward · women | 5,157 | 69.7 | 114 | 69 |
